HIDING SUNRISE is a collection of journal entries and related sources that share with the reader stories of depression, self-injury, eating disorders, hospitalizations, friendship, death, the ups and downs of teenage years, and learning to survive it all. Included inside are drawings, logs, short stories and poetry to add onto the story and deepen it. It's really many stories in one, a hundred little pieces of a large puzzle nested inside the covers of a book. Are all the pieces there? No. But it's enough to take a good glimpse into the world of the person's soul enclosed. "Get ready to meet Felicity Dawn Monroe. Because she's ready to meet you." Fact: The name of this book actually came from a project that was done in an inpatient psychiatric hospital. The patients were asked to come up with their own 2-word Native American name that described them, whether it was a hidden meaning or not. Then they were to draw a mini poster for the name. I had come up with "Hiding Sunrise"; it's multi-descriptive. For one, my middle name is Dawn, which can be associated with Sunrise. Hiding means that I was sort of in hiding, zoned out, depressed, not a part of the world. And then, Hiding Sunrise altogether could mean that I had a lot going for me, that I was meant to do great stuff and leave an impact on people, but that I had yet to show them and shine through. My poster is the first picture enclosed in the book.
